05.01.2022 We are sharing something that we wrote a few years ago, and it is still relevant! While winter may be a down time for breeding there is still plenty to do in pr...eparation for next season! For many clients there is the dilemma of choosing the stallion that will make the best match with his or her mare. Here are a few points to consider: If you have an older mare or one that has been difficult to breed in the past, try a nice young stallion that offers fresh or cool shipped semen. This should increase your chances as younger stallions generally have more active and more potent semen samples. Frozen semen can be risky for problem mares as the semen is generally not as active as it has been through the freezing/thawing process. It may end up taking several cycles for your older mare to conceive, therefore becoming expensive. And why AI rather than live cover? With AI we can control the amount of semen that we put in, we can also control where we place the semen in the mare's tract, and we can use semen extender that has a bit of antibiotic. We can also look at the semen sample under a microscope to make sure it looks motile. AI also reduces risk of injury to the mare during live cover. Live cover can be the best option for select mares and stallions, please ring to discuss if you have a query. If you have a young or very fertile mare, and you choose to use frozen semen, it is best to organise in advance. Frozen semen can be shipped to our clinic and stored BEFORE your mare arrives, in case you bring her to us and she is ready to breed! If you were wanting to breed your mare early in the season, it is ideal to start rugging and feeding your mare in late July or August and take note of her cycles if she begins cycling. We generally do not start accepting mares until September, and our recipient herd is not usually ready for embryo transfers until October. 04.01.2022 It was with great sadness that I heard of the passing of Phillip Kirkby. I met Phillip 28 yrs ago and bought my first two registered ASHs from him a colt by Omega and a filly by by Remedy. Phillip was one of two of the most influential people in my life in regards to horse breeding and genetics. Phillip bred horses that he believed in not what fashion dictated and that showed in every animal he bred. I have no doubt that his legacy will be felt for many many years to come. So heres to you Mr Kirkby fly high with great horses you have bred of a past time.
